Dundonald Bluebell, Football Nation East of Scotland Qualifying Cup Round 2, Moorside Park, Saturday 13 October 2018

Moorside Park, the home of Dundonald Bluebell is the venue for Bo’ness United’s Football Nation Cup second round tie this weekend. Bluebell received a bye into this stage while the BUs are here courtesy of Fraser Keast’s extra time winner at home to Crossgates Primrose, the only goal of that game.

Bo’ness have had the edge over Dundonald in the last couple of seasons but nothing to counter the fact this will be a very difficult game of football. Last season the BUs won in Fife with goals from Stuart Hunter and Ryan Millar, although the year before were on the end of a hammering, conceding five goals without reply. A brace each from Lewis McKenzie and Barry Sibanda with one from Scott Lawrie did the damage that day.

Both teams are new to the East of Scotland League, Dundonald also in Conference B, and Bo’ness return to Moorfield Park for a league game in a couple of weeks. A top league place for next season may be a priority but this will not stop the sides wanting a victory this weekend.

Dundonald are above Bo’ness in the Table but have played two games more. They won against Dalkeith Thistle last Saturday but two weeks before lost out to Lothian Thistle, both games at home. It is difficult to judge how the teams have developed since last season but Saturday will tell.

Bo’ness were disappointed to drop points against Haddington on Saturday where after a close first half the BUs dominated after the break, but the scourge of missed chances was again to the fore. Everyone at the club knows this is a problem and are working to resolve the issue, whether finding a goal scorer to bring in or seeing the existing strikers finding the necessary touch in front of goal.

A tough game is in prospect and the BU Faithful will be there to support the players and encourage the team to what will hopefully be a successful day.
